首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

gpucpu并行计算

在云计算领域,GPU和CPU并行计算是一个非常重要的概念。GPU和CPU是计算机的两个重要组成部分,它们在处理任务时各有优势。GPU(图形处理器)主要用于处理图形和视频,而CPU(中央处理器)则负责处理大部分其他任务。

然而,在某些情况下,GPU和CPU并行计算可以显著提高计算性能。例如,在深度学习和人工智能领域,GPU和CPU可以同时处理大量数据,从而加快训练速度和提高模型性能。

在云计算中,可以使用腾讯云的GPU云服务器来实现GPU并行计算。腾讯云的GPU云服务器配备了NVIDIA的GPU加速器,可以为用户提供高性能的计算能力。这些服务器可以用于处理大量数据、进行机器学习和人工智能任务等。

此外,腾讯云还提供了一系列的云计算产品,例如腾讯云CVM、腾讯云GPU云服务器、腾讯云负载均衡、腾讯云数据库等,这些产品都可以与GPU并行计算相结合,以提高计算性能和应用范围。

总之,GPU和CPU并行计算是一个非常重要的概念,可以显著提高计算性能和应用范围。在腾讯云中,可以使用GPU云服务器来实现GPU并行计算,并结合其他云计算产品,以满足各种计算需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 并行计算简介_并行计算实验报告

    1 什么是并行计算?...并行计算: 简单来讲,并行计算就是同时使用多个计算资源来解决一个计算问题: 一个问题被分解成为一系列可以并发执行的离散部分; 每个部分可以进一步被分解成为一系列离散指令; 来自每个部分的指令可以在不同的处理器上被同时执行...那么冯诺依曼体系结构和并行计算有什么关系呢?答案是:并行计算机仍然遵从这一基本架构,只是处理单元多于一个而已,其它的基本架构完全保持不变。...2.2 弗林的经典分类 有不同的方法对并行计算机进行分类(具体例子可参见并行计算分类)。 一种被广泛采用的分类被称为弗林经典分类,诞生于1966年。...3 并行计算机的内存架构 3.1 共享内存 一般特征: 共享内存的并行计算机虽然也分很多种,但是通常而言,它们都可以让所有处理器以全局寻址的方式访问所有的内存空间。

    78220

    Mathematica 的并行计算

    与此同时,并行计算机的格局已经稳定并演变为三种架构:多核机器、托管集群和 PC 的自组织网络。...只要您使用其中一个并行命令(例如并行计算表的元素),Mathematica 就会在每个内核上启动一个额外的内核并分配工作。...Mathematica 也是分析并行计算性能的最佳工具。在这里,我们测量了两个远程内核的基本延迟。延迟只是简单计算的往返时间。 并非所有计算都受益于并行化。...其中一个不走运,得到了所有困难的情况(素性测试的时间变化很大),因此,另一个内核基本上处于空闲状态——这在并行计算中不是您想要的。...Mathematica适用于多核桌面 PC, gridMathematica Server适用于网络上的所有其他计算机,为并行计算提供了一个易于使用、功能强大的交互式系统。

    1.9K10

    C++与并行计算:利用并行计算加速程序运行

    C++与并行计算:利用并行计算加速程序运行在计算机科学中,程序运行效率是一个重要的考量因素。针对需要处理大量数据或复杂计算任务的程序,使用并行计算技术可以大幅度加速程序的运行速度。...什么是并行计算并行计算是指将一个大型计算任务分解为多个小任务,并将这些小任务同时执行以提高计算速度的方法。...而并行计算可以同时执行多个任务,充分利用计算资源,显著提升计算效率。C++中的并行计算工具C++作为一种高级编程语言,提供了多种并行计算的工具和库,可以方便地实现并行计算。...性能测试和调优:并行计算程序的性能取决于多个因素,包括硬件环境、任务划分、算法优化等。对并行计算程序进行性能测试和调优是必要的,以找到性能瓶颈并优化程序。...结论利用并行计算可以大大加速程序的运行速度,提高计算效率。C++提供了多种并行计算工具和技术,如OpenMP、MPI和TBB等,可以帮助开发人员充分利用计算资源,实现高性能的并行计算

    68810

    何去何从的并行计算

    无论出于何种原因,你正对并行计算充满好奇、疑问和求知欲。 不过首先,要公布一条令人沮丧的消息。...而正是这位传奇人物,给目前红红火火的并行计算泼了一大盆冷水。那么,并行计算究竟应该何去何从呢?...(需要有多么奇葩的想象力才能想象出并行计算的用武之地? 并行计算只能在图像处理和服务端程序两个领域使用,并且它在这两个领域已经有了大量广泛的使用。但是在其他任何地方,并行计算毫无建树!...由此,并行计算就被非常自然地推广开来,随之而来的问题也层出不穷,程序员的黑暗时期也随之到来。 简化的硬件设计方案必然带来软件设计的复杂性。...而对并行计算的研究,就是希望给这片黑暗带来光明。 本文节选自《实战Java高并发程序设计(第3版)》一书,想了解更多关于并发编程的内容,欢迎阅读此书!

    52620

    Assemble|并行计算|SuperScalar

    前置: 本文附图类似于甘特图,横向可以并行计算,纵向则必须顺序执行,高度代表执行时间,每个重复单元代表一次迭代。...由于不同变量的累乘彼此独立,因此SuperScalar被触发,两个乘法可以并行计算。最终,通过扩大一倍步长,我们节约了一半的执行时间。随着步长递增,执行时间也会减少。...Hint: 由于计算资源有限,并行计算过多时,寄存器可能无法存下操作数,存入内存,导致减缓;此外,本身执行单元的数目有限。...Associative 我们这次把和结果相乘的operand先相乘,然后和结果相乘,由于前者并不涉及res,因此彼此之间无依赖关系,可以并行计算。而后者必须顺序执行。

    64230

    并行计算——OpenMP加速矩阵相乘

    由于GPU的cuda核心非常多,可以进行大量的并行计算,所以我们更多的谈论的是GPU并行计算(参见拙文《浅析GPU计算——CPU和GPU的选择》和《浅析GPU计算——cuda编程》)。...(转载请指明出于breaksoftware的csdn博客)         并行计算的一个比较麻烦的问题就是数据同步,我们使用经典的矩阵相乘来绕开这些不是本文关心的问题。...非并行计算 ?        由于是4核8线程,所以CPU最高处在12%(100% 除以8),而且有抖动。 并行计算 ?         CPU资源被占满,长期处在100%状态。...时间对比 非并行计算:243,109ms 并行计算:68,800ms         可见,在我这个环境下,并行计算将速度提升了4倍。...非并行计算 std::vector result; result.resize(left->get_height() * right->get_width()); {

    2.9K30

    Chatgpt问答之WRF-并行计算

    因此,WRF采用了并行计算的方法,将计算任务分配给多个计算节点同时处理,以加快计算速度。 WRF的并行计算可以分为两个层面:水平并行和垂直并行。...在WRF中,垂直方向的计算通常采用了OpenMP并行计算技术,OpenMP是一种共享内存并行计算技术,可以将多个线程同时运行在同一个计算节点上。...WRF的并行计算需要在编译时指定编译选项,以支持MPI和OpenMP的并行计算。在运行WRF模拟时,还需要通过设置运行参数,指定计算节点的数量和计算任务的分配方式等。...3、WRF在实际运行中,是怎么实现its, ite, jts, jte, kts, kte并行计算的? WRF在实际运行中通过MPI(Message Passing Interface)实现并行计算。...因为WRF采用MPI并行计算,因此可以运行在多台计算机上。每台计算机上运行多个MPI进程,这些进程在不同的计算节点之间进行通信,从而形成一个大规模的并行计算系统。

    63230
    领券